Arduino Weather Station

have you work with Vector instruments before ?
anemometer
https://www.windspeed.co.uk/ws/index.php?option=displaypage&op=page&Itemid=48

also
windvane
https://www.windspeed.co.uk/ws/index.php?option=displaypage&Itemid=59&op=page&SubMenu=